Tiny 1-micron pure gold flakes floating in the bottle give the Barossa Valley &#8216;Gold&#8217; Chardonnay shimmering looks besides making it a party protagonist.<\/div>\n<div class=\"articledata\">\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.indianwineacademy.com\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/12\/yellow.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ignleft wp-image-12545 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.indianwineacademy.com\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/12\/yellow.jpg\" alt=\"Feature: Now Drink Gold with Wine \" width=\"137\" height=\"181\"><\/a><\/p>\n<p>Produced by Napa based Hundred Acres known for its cult wine Kayli Morgan Cabernet Sauvignon, &#8216;Gold&#8217; is an un-oaked Chardonnay (70%) with a blend of aromatic Gew\u00fcrztraminer and the spicy Viognier, making it a friendly wine with Indian food as well. The dosage of real 24 karat gold flakes dancing in the bottle, gives it the glam look and feel.<\/p>\n<p>The producer and winemaker Jayson Woodbridge is highly regarded in California. Quite tired of the heavy oak style that rules the US and Australian Chardonnay, he decided to go for pure, clean and unoaked chardonnay without any oak contact to make a fresh wine. The pure and fresh aromas of peaches and pineapples, and the tropical scents of lichee and honey welcome you and carry it through to the flavour.<\/p>\n<p>Using a clever and ingenious first time initiative in the industry, Woodbridge bottles and releases Gold twice a year. Wine released in July is made from the grapes from Barossa valley in Australia, shipped at sub-freezing temperatures of -3\u00b0 C that keeps the juice fresh and preserves mouthfeel and freshness. The November release is from Napa Valley fruit. The dosage of 1-micron gold flakes is added before bottling in a clear French glass bottle.<\/p>\n<p>Gold is also available at in a Pink version known as <em>Vin Gris. <\/em>Though the colour qualifies it to be a Ros\u00e9, the grape varietals include red Cabernet and the white Chardonnay, Gewurztraminer and Viognier (unlike a Ros\u00e9 where the grape is usually red and the colour is extracted by bleeding the juice before the contact with the skins).<\/p>\n<p>The surprising part of this wine is that it has been very reasonable priced, at least in the US market where both wines retail well under $30. And gold was selling much cheaper then.<\/p>\n<p>Comparatively, Gold would be a great bargain for the flashy and flamboyant, young and trendy wine lovers or for those celebrating special occasions and could give Champagne a run for the money.<\/p>\n<p>Both versions are dry, fruit-driven with a creamy texture and persistent finish and make excellent aperitifs. Pink is heavier bodied than the pale coloured Gold. This wine may not get the nod of approval from the purists who would not be impressed by the 999.9 purity of Gold in it. It is not meant to snub the snobs though many wine lovers in the restaurants may want to do just that.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.indianwineacademy.com\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/12\/pink.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ignright wp-image-12550 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.indianwineacademy.com\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/12\/pink.jpg\" alt=\"Feature: Now Drink Gold with Wine\" width=\"137\" height=\"181\"><\/a><\/p>\n<p>Does Gold add to the health effects of wine? We have not been able to test the veracity but Ayurvedic tonics do use metals like gold and silver for their supposed aphrodisiac value. According to the ancient alchemist concepts, gold possesses legendary powers which contribute to a long and vital life. Incidentally, another label had entered in the Indian market a few years ago. One of their white wines also carried gold flakes. It caught on very well in Punjab where the young and rich took instant fancy to it as they presumed it added to virility.<\/p>\n<p>Gold is being imported by Wine Legend India Pvt.
